ST. PETERSBURG, Fla. (Aug. 26, 2024) — The Poynter Institute is happy to announce the 22 journalists chosen for its 2024 Management Academy for Variety in Media, a prestigious, weeklong, in-person coaching seminar that connects and empowers numerous leaders.

“It’s a particular honor to facilitate this group of journalists,” mentioned Tony Elkins, Poynter college and co-director of the 2024 academy. “It’s certainly one of my biggest joys to create a studying atmosphere the place numerous journalists can develop the management abilities that may allow them to construct higher newsrooms and groups.”

Elkins mentioned that this yr, the school crew is placing an emphasis on working inside organizations and with one another. 

“This program is targeted on how we develop human-centered abilities — the methods we join with one another via the lens of journalism — so we will empower our cohort to remodel their very own careers, groups and workplaces,” he mentioned. “When folks go away our campus, they are going to have a toolkit to assist them handle initiatives and their time, talk higher with their staff and friends, perceive the worth of suggestions, information distributed groups, admire how essential onboarding is, and a lot extra. And it’s not simply these abilities they are going to be taking dwelling – members of our management applications foster deep connections with their peer teams they are going to take with them the remainder of their profession.” 

These chosen for this yr’s coaching symbolize a cross part of the journalism trade, from legacy newspapers to mainstream community information to on-line startups.

“I’ve been impressed with how this yr’s cohort members are already doing rather a lot to help new journalists of their organizations — an indication that the long run will likely be OK,” mentioned Kathy Lu, Poynter adjunct college and co-director of this yr’s academy. “We have now members working in newspapers and audio, nationally and internationally. I’m so grateful to their organizations for investing in these great and conscientious journalists at one more troublesome second in our trade. I stay up for seeing what we are going to all study collectively.”

Candidates are chosen with an emphasis on making certain range throughout race and ethnicity, geography, expertise platforms, group dimension and ability units.

Yearly, Poynter evaluations trade developments and designs the academy based mostly on participant wants. This yr, many within the cohort mentioned they had been curious about studying extra about managing feelings and stress/burnout,  each of which will likely be addressed all through the week. 

The kick-off occasion of this yr’s academy, which takes place Sept. 9-13 in St. Petersburg, Florida, will likely be a Q&A with Elkins and Lu about their profession journeys.

Different classes embrace:

  • Efficient strategies for managing folks throughout many variations, together with digital language and generational kinds, led by Elkins.
  • Negotiation techniques and navigating troublesome however honest conversations with Lu.
  • Intentional delegation, main along with your strengths and utilizing human-centered design to study empathy with Elkins.
  • Ethics in journalism with Kelly McBride, senior vice chairman and chair of the Craig Newmark Middle for Ethics and Management at Poynter.

Through the academy, contributors will obtain teaching from skilled journalists, together with Poynter college member Doris Truong, award-winning editor Maria Carrillo and Dalia Colón, reporter and host of The Zest Podcast at WUSF.

The 2023 Management Academy for Variety in Media is made potential because of help from the Tegna Basis and Craig Newmark Philanthropies.
